21. The Organisational Challenges of Implementing eHealth Services: : A Case Study on The Patient Self-Test Application in Centre for Rheumatology
University essay from KTH/Industriell ManagementAbstract : It is widely believed that eHealth will play a vital role in the development and shaping of healthcare systems in the twenty first century. However, despite all documented reports and benefits of eHealth technologies, many attempts to extend successful pilot projects have not sufficiently met promised results and to a large extent failed. 24. Innovation in Healthcare, An analysis of the regional preconditions in Skåne for innovation in digital healthcare.
University essay from Lunds universitet/ProduktionsekonomiAbstract : The upcoming changes in the demographic structure will put pressure on the healthcare system in Skåne. Tax financed hospitals with more beds, doctors, nurses and other personnel will not be the solution to cope with the upcoming demands. Increasing healthcare productivity is one way, where digital healthcare is a potential part of the solution. READ MORE

25. eHealth development in Sweden : A study of prominent aspects and benefits from a multi-userperspective
University essay from KTH/Industriell ManagementAbstract : The European health care is facing challenges with an increasing ageing population, with a higher frequency of chronic diseases, which have resulted in rising health care costs. Meanwhile, the trend shows how patients and citizens are becoming more active in their personal health care, with the number of existing doctors and nurses subsiding furthermore entailing problems.
